  The goal of Medicaid Program Integrity (MPI) is to protect the Medicaid Program from Fraud, Abuse and Waste.

  The Bureau of Medicaid Program Integrity does this specifically through audits and investigations of healthcare providers suspected of engaging in fraudulent or abusive behavior, as well as overpayment recoveries, administrative sanctions, and the referral of suspected fraud or other criminal activities for law enforcement investigation.

  The Data Analysis Unit is a dynamic and fast-paced unit within MPI that works closely with other units to serve the overall bureau mission.

  To address the complexity and scope of fraudulent and abusive behavior in the Florida Medicaid program, the Data Analysis Unit is responsible for developing novel methods and technologies to fight fraud, abuse, and waste.

  To do this, the highly collaborative and innovative unit relies on a team with diverse educational and experience backgrounds.

  This position requires a strong background in data science/statistical methods as well as a desire to innovate.

  The selected candidate will assist in detecting and developing leads related to fraud, abuse, and waste through research and analysis of complex health and business-related data.

  Included in the functions of this position are activities such as:

  • Compiling, cleaning, and processing data from unstructured sources

  • Utilizing large data sets from structured data sources such as data warehouses and public data repositories

  • Creating analysis pipelines that integrate data from many independent sources (both structured and unstructured)

  • Building high quality models to generate leads for investigation

  • Writing SQL queries/stored-procedures in Microsoft SQL Server and Oracle SQL Developer

  • Performing complex analysis in statistical programming languages such as R, SAS, and Python

  • Creation of interactive data visualization in tools such as Tableau, Power BI, or R Shiny as well as generating static data reports

  What is OPS employment?

  OPS employment is a temporary employer/employee relationship used for accomplishing short term or intermittent tasks. OPS employees are at-will employees and are subject to actions such as pay changes, changes to work assignment, and terminations at the pleasure of the agency head or designee.

  OPS employees do not serve probationary periods or become permanent in their positions because they serve at the pleasure of the agency head.

  BACKGROUND SCREENING

  It is the policy of the Florida Agency for Health Care Administration that any applicant being considered for employment must successfully complete a State and National criminal history check as a condition of employment before beginning employment, and, if applicable, also be screened in accordance with the requirements of Chapter 435, F.S., and Chapter 408, F.S. No applicant may begin employment until the background screening results are received, reviewed for any disqualifying offenses, and approved by the Agency. Background screening shall include, but not be limited to, fingerprinting for State and Federal criminal records checks through the Florida Department of Law Enforcement (FDLE) and Federal Bureau of Investigation (FBI) and may include local criminal history checks through local law enforcement agencies.
